Output 5c44c08c622a9b52a290e4a6b19066dcf8d0e92caea3fe68b79ee327f82017a0:1

value
1686323
script pubkey
OP_0 OP_PUSHBYTES_20 ce3c3a3b6d0a531494d16b1aff93d045b31ba789
address
bc1qec7r5wmdpff3f9x3dvd0ly7sgke3hfuf0gycud
transaction
5c44c08c622a9b52a290e4a6b19066dcf8d0e92caea3fe68b79ee327f82017a0